Franky was sent to Wentworth after she was charged with assault for throwing boiling oil on a television presenter of a cooking show that she was participating on for criticizing her food. Boomer is often portrayed as a slow and sometimes mentally challenged individual but, it is revealed that she has Fetal Alcohol Spectrum Disorder as a result of her mother ingesting alcohol while she was pregnant with Boomer. Karen 'Kaz' Proctor was an inmate of Wentworth Correctional Facility and a main character of the Foxtel series Wentworth.She is portrayed by Tammy Macintosh.. She was first introduced in Series 3, Episode 1 as an advocate and fan of Bea Smith.It was later established that she was the leader of vigilante justice group, The Red Right Hand.
